French Ambassador visits Farsons Brewery 5/29/2006

The French Ambassador, His Excellency Mr Jean-Marc Rives, last week paid an official visit to the Farsons Brewery in Mriehel.

Mr Rives, who was accompanied by the Commercial Attaché, Mr Francois Dubois, was welcomed by the Farsons Group Chairman, Mr Bryan Gera and Farsons Group Chief Executive, Mr Louis A Farrugia. He was shown round the Brewery by Mr Ray Sciberras – Chief Production Officer, and by Mr Eugenio Caruana – Head Brewer.

As well as visiting the Brew House, the Beer Bottling Hall, and the award-winning Process Block, boasting state-of-the-art brewing technology, the delegation visited the PET Bottling Area where significant investment in machinery from France has been made.

Mr Rives was also informed of the Group’s Lm14 million investment in the construction of a new Brew House, a new Soft Drinks Packaging Hall and a new Distribution Centre.

“Farsons remains committed to its ongoing investment programme in order to provide Maltese and tourists with the best products. We are doing this so as to retain our longstanding leading position in those sectors in which we operate,” said Mr Farrugia.

Mr Rives also met members of the Group Executive Board in the Company’s Board Room after the tour of the Brewery.
